boy. Honestly. I checked a few other reviews on the surface and some saying its fine too LOL. for me and what I advise people is to use the device first.
In terms of the android tablet market, if you're looking for apps like what's on the iPad in terms of quality, get an iPad. If you need something for just browsing, mail, YouTube; you can risk it. But again, find one to use before you make a decision because at the end of the day it is you who have to use it and what works for me, might not apply.
I personally own a Touchpad with Android installed and quirks aside, it works for me. (minus the weight and battery life)
